- [ ] Step 7: Archive cold storage buckets (Glacierline tier). Confirm both ceremony witnesses are present, verify bucket manifests match the Oxbow ledger, then seal the archive key shares. Plugin authors may observe but not handle shares. Once sealed, the archive index itself is encrypted and can only be reopened with the passphrase below.

vault phrase of badup-hahig = tamael-aldael-kelmir-istael-fenok-istwyn-tamius-jorath-oliion

# Break-Glass: Catalog Cache Invalidation

Scope: the Pinrow product catalog at Veldstone Retail. If stale prices persist after a purge and the Hollowmere invalidation queue is wedged, use break-glass to flush the edge tier directly. Contractors: get verbal sign-off from the catalog lead first. Steps: open the Hollowmere admin shell, select emergency-flush, confirm the tenant, and run it once — repeated flushes thrash the origin. Access is logged and expires after 20 minutes. Unseal the admin shell with the passphrase below.

recovery phrase for kahop-tajog: istix-casvan

## Partner SFTP Drop — Marlowe Freight

Files land nightly between 02:00–03:30 UTC in the inbound drop. Watcher job `marlowe-ingest` picks them up; if nothing arrives by 04:00, the Quillhook alert fires. Do NOT re-request files from Marlowe before checking the quarantine folder — malformed headers get parked there silently. Retries are safe; ingest is idempotent on file checksum. Rotation of the drop credentials is quarterly, owned by platform. Full escalation steps and contacts are on the runbook page.

dashboard of taduf-tahof = https://confluence.tolvaqlabs.internal/browse/browse/display/f01240ca